CSU vs. Penn State Lehigh Valley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, CSU or Penn State Lehigh Valley?

  • Penn State Lehigh Valley is 91% more expensive to attend than CSU for in-state tuition ($14,624.00 vs. $7,656.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 217.6% higher at Penn State Lehigh Valley than Chicago State University ($24,318.00 vs. $7,656.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Chicago State University than Penn State Lehigh Valley ($6,446 vs. $18,142)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Penn State Lehigh Valley are 6.3% lower than costs at Chicago State University ($12,984 vs. $13,800)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Chicago State University than Penn State Lehigh Valley (93% vs. 78%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Chicago State University students is 60.7% larger than aid received Penn State Lehigh Valley ($15,891 vs. $9,886)

CSU vs. Penn State Lehigh Valley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, CSU or Penn State Lehigh Valley?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Penn State Lehigh Valley and CSU.

  • The graduation rate at Penn State Lehigh Valley is higher than Chicago State University (47% vs. 21%)
  • Graduates from Penn State Lehigh Valley earn on average $17,000 more per year than CSU graduates after ten years. ($55,300 vs. $38,300)
  • Penn State Lehigh Valley students graduate with a $4,432 lower median federal student loan debt than CSU graduates. ($26,818 vs. $31,250)
  • Penn State Lehigh Valley graduates are paying $46 less per month on federal student loans than CSU graduates. ($277 vs. $323)
  • More Penn State Lehigh Valley gra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former CSU students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 25%)
